Aphria to allocate $350 million under shelf to convertibles resale

By Sarah Lizee

Olympia, Wash., Aug. 23 – Aphria Inc. intends to allocate $350 million of the capacity under a shelf prospectus to provide for the resale of convertible notes, according to a press release.

The filing of the shelf prospectus satisfies one of the company's contractual obligations to its syndicate of underwriters in connection with the $350 million of convertible senior notes issued by the company on April 23.

Aphria is a Leamington, Ont.-based global cannabis company.
